1996 Alfa Romeo 145 vs. 1990 Daihatsu Applause
To start off, 1996 Alfa Romeo 145 is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 Daihatsu Applause.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 Daihatsu Applause would be higher. At 1,590 cc (4 cylinders), 1990 Daihatsu Applause is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, both vehicles can yield 90 horse power. So under normal driving conditions, the acceleration of both vehicles should be relatively similar.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1996 Alfa Romeo 145 weights approximately 210 kg more than 1990 Daihatsu Applause.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1990 Daihatsu Applause (130 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 15 more torque (in Nm) than 1996 Alfa Romeo 145. (115 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 1990 Daihatsu Applause will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1996 Alfa Romeo 145.
Compare all specifications:
1996 Alfa Romeo 145 | 1990 Daihatsu Applause |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Daihatsu |
Model | 145 | Applause |
Year Released | 1996 | 1990 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1351 cc | 1590 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 90 HP | 90 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 115 Nm | 130 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4400 RPM | 3500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1140 kg | 930 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4100 mm | 4270 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1720 mm | 1670 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1430 mm | 1380 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2550 mm | 2480 mm |
